阿里云服务器如何搭建网站,阿里云服务器搭建网站全攻略,从入门到精通
- 综合资讯
- 2025-03-25 04:42:57
- 2

阿里云服务器搭建网站全攻略,涵盖从入门到精通的步骤,包括选择合适的服务器配置、购买域名、配置服务器环境、上传网站文件、设置数据库和SSL证书等关键环节,助您轻松掌握网站...
阿里云服务器搭建网站全攻略,涵盖从入门到精通的步骤,包括选择合适的服务器配置、购买域名、配置服务器环境、上传网站文件、设置数据库和SSL证书等关键环节,助您轻松掌握网站搭建全过程。
随着互联网的飞速发展,越来越多的企业和个人开始关注网站建设,而阿里云服务器作为国内领先的云服务提供商,凭借其稳定、安全、高效的特点,成为了许多企业和个人搭建网站的首选,本文将详细讲解如何在阿里云服务器上搭建网站,帮助您轻松入门并精通。
准备工作
-
阿里云账号:您需要注册一个阿里云账号,并完成实名认证。
图片来源于网络,如有侵权联系删除
-
阿里云服务器:根据您的需求,选择合适的阿里云服务器产品,阿里云提供多种服务器类型,如ECS、Elastic Compute Service等。
-
网络带宽:根据您的网站流量需求,选择合适的网络带宽。
-
数据盘:根据您的存储需求,选择合适的数据盘大小。
-
操作系统:阿里云服务器支持多种操作系统,如Linux、Windows等,建议选择Linux操作系统,因为它更加稳定、安全。
-
域名:购买一个适合您网站的域名,并在阿里云进行解析。
搭建网站
登录阿里云管理控制台
登录阿里云管理控制台,选择“产品与服务”>“弹性计算”>“Elastic Compute Service”,进入ECS管理页面。
创建ECS实例
点击“创建实例”,根据您的需求选择合适的配置,填写相关信息,如地域、可用区、实例规格、镜像、网络和安全组等。
设置安全组
在创建ECS实例的过程中,需要设置安全组,安全组类似于防火墙,用于控制进出ECS实例的网络流量,您可以根据需要添加或修改安全组规则。
登录ECS实例
创建ECS实例后,等待片刻,然后登录实例,您可以选择SSH密钥对或密码登录,若选择SSH密钥对,请确保您已经生成了SSH密钥对,并将其导入阿里云。
安装LAMP环境(以Linux为例)
LAMP环境包括Linux操作系统、Apache服务器、MySQL数据库和PHP编程语言,以下是在Linux服务器上安装LAMP环境的步骤:
(1)更新系统源
sudo apt-get update
(2)安装Apache服务器
sudo apt-get install apache2
(3)安装MySQL数据库
sudo apt-get install mysql-server
(4)安装PHP编程语言
图片来源于网络,如有侵权联系删除
sudo apt-get install php
(5)安装PHP扩展
sudo apt-get install php-mysql php-gd php-xml php-zip
配置Apache服务器
进入Apache服务器配置文件目录:
cd /etc/apache2
sudo nano sites-available/000-default.conf
ServerName www.yourdomain.com
将www.yourdomain.com
替换为您购买的域名。
启动Apache服务器
sudo systemctl start apache2
配置MySQL数据库
登录MySQL数据库:
sudo mysql
创建数据库和用户:
CREATE DATABASE yourdatabase;
CREATE USER 'yourusername'@'localhost' IDENTIFIED BY 'yourpassword';
GRANT ALL PRIVILEGES ON yourdatabase.* TO 'yourusername'@'localhost';
FLUSH PRIVILEGES;
EXIT;
将yourdatabase
、yourusername
和yourpassword
替换为您自己的数据库、用户和密码。
配置PHP环境
在Apache服务器配置文件目录中,创建一个新的配置文件:
sudo nano sites-available/yourdomain.com.conf
<VirtualHost *:80>
ServerAdmin webmaster@yourdomain.com
ServerName yourdomain.com
DocumentRoot /var/www/html/yourdomain.com
ErrorLog ${APACHE_LOG_DIR}/error.log
C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>
将yourdomain.com
替换为您购买的域名。
重启Apache服务器
sudo systemctl restart apache2
上传网站文件
将您的网站文件上传到ECS实例的/var/www/html/yourdomain.com
目录下。
测试网站
在浏览器中输入您的域名,如果一切正常,您应该能看到您的网站。
通过以上步骤,您已经在阿里云服务器上成功搭建了一个网站,这只是搭建网站的基础,您还可以根据需求进行更多配置,如优化网站性能、设置HTTPS等,希望本文能帮助您轻松入门并精通阿里云服务器搭建网站。
本文链接:https://www.zhitaoyun.cn/1892020.html
发表评论